Gitanjali Angmo has reported to the Supreme Court that she is experiencing continuous surveillance that violates her constitutional rights.
New Delhi:
Gitanjali Angmo, the wife of Ladakh statehood activist Sonam Wangchuk, has submitted an affidavit to the Supreme Court claiming she has been under constant surveillance since arriving in Delhi following her husband's arrest. Wangchuk was detained on allegations of inciting protesters and having links to Pakistan.
In her affidavit, Angmo stated: "I am being followed and under surveillance in Delhi constantly. I have observed this fact after I came to Delhi on 30.09.2025 and held a press conference in Delhi on the same day. As soon as I step out of my accommodation in Delhi after 30.09.2025, a car and a man on a bike trail me wherever I go across Delhi."
She emphasized that this surveillance directly conflicts with her constitutional rights.
Wangchuk was arrested on September 27 on charges of inciting a mob, three days after a statehood protest turned violent, resulting in four fatalities. He is currently detained in a Jodhpur jail in Rajasthan under the stringent National Security Act (NSA).
After visiting her husband in jail last week, Angmo appealed to both the Prime Minister and the President for his release. She has also legally challenged Wangchuk's arrest in the Supreme Court, questioning the application of the NSA against him.
Angmo previously denied Ladakh police allegations that her husband had communicated with a Pakistani intelligence operative. "That is the failure of the Ministry of Home Affairs if they have found such a thing. What has the MHA been doing that a Pakistani intelligence person is roaming here? They have failed in their duty. I want them to be answerable," she told NDTV.
Angmo, who works as a social entrepreneur, claimed they have been subjected to a "witch hunt" since her husband advocated for establishing a legislature in the Union Territory.
